<br />"Section 203. The term "assessment roll" <br />means the last equalized assessment roll on <br />which district or improvement district taxes <br />are collected." <br />Section 2. Section 204 of the Ordinance is hereby <br />amended to read as follows: <br />"Section 204. The term "assessor" means <br />district or improvement district assessor unless <br />the district or improvement district taxes are <br />assessed by the county assessor in which event <br />it means the county assessor." <br />Section 3. Section 1307 of the Ordinance is hereby <br />amended to reaQ as follows: <br />"Section 1307. Collection of Taxes. All <br />taxes provided by this chapter shall be levied <br />and collected at the same time, in the same manner, <br />and upon the same assessment roll, and have the <br />same penalties, interest, costs and provisions <br />for redemption and sale for non-payment, as gen- <br />eral city taxes, except that the amounts and pur- <br />poses of all such taxes shall be set forth in the <br />ordinance levying such taxes and that Sections <br />51 and 51.5 of the Charter shall not be applicable <br />to any district or improvement district; and ex- <br />cept that the Council may by ordinance retain as <br />to anyone or more districts or improvement dis- <br />tricts either or both of the powers of (a) <br /> <br />2 <br />
